| 20090013275 | SYSTEM AND METHOD FOR QUICK VIEW OF APPLICATION DATA ON A HOME SCREEN INTERFACE TRIGGERED BY A SCROLL/FOCUS ACTION - A home screen user interface permits a user to select an application icon to trigger a quick preview of event data maintained by the associated application. The home screen presents a background and a predetermined number of application icons arranged on the home screen to enable viewing of a majority of the background. At least some of the application icons are operable to invoke respective user interfaces for event applications that manage respective data communication, voice communication and calendar events. Upon a user selecting an application icon corresponding to the respective event application, event data is displayed, preferably after a time delay, on a portion of the home screen. | 01-08-2009 |
| 20090013387 | SYSTEM AND METHOD FOR MANAGING DELIVERY OF INTERNET CONTENT - Disclosed are a system and method for managing delivery of pushed web content to communication devices. In an embodiment, the method comprises: uniquely identifying a communication device to which the pushed web content is to be delivered; establishing a pushed web content service linking the pushed web content to the communication device; receiving a pushed web content service request; and permitting delivery of content to the communication device via the pushed web content service based on verification of the identity of a trusted pushed web content provider. The method may further comprise uniquely identifying the pushed web content provider with an assignable unique pushed web content identification. | 01-08-2009 |
| 20090300547 | RECOMMENDER SYSTEM FOR ON-LINE ARTICLES AND DOCUMENTS - A system and method for recommending on-line articles and documents to users is disclosed. The method provides an article widget user interface and a full-screen widget user interfaces to allow a user to rate articles, to preview articles, to filter articles based on category, article length, or other characteristics. A recommender system is configured to provide a continually refreshing list of recommended articles to the user via the user interfaces. The system comprises a module configured to monitor the user's explicit and implicit interactions with the user interfaces, and provides a refreshed list of recommended articles accordingly. The recommender system may be configured to use a package of approaches including rule-based, content-based or collaborative filtering approaches including Slope, Co-Visitation, Mwinnow and Clustering/Co-clustering. | 12-03-2009 |
| 20100279620 | SYSTEM, METHOD AND MOBILE DEVICE FOR DISPLAYING WIRELESS MODE INDICATORS - Embodiments relate to a mobile device comprising: a processor; a display responsive to the processor; a plurality of wireless communication subsystems responsive to the processor; and a memory. The memory is accessible to the processor and stores program code executable by the processor for executing a user interface application. The user interface application is configured to determine a first connection status of the mobile device with respect to a cellular network and a second connection status with respect to a wireless local area network (WLAN). The user interface application, when executed by the processor, is further configured to cause the display to display a selected combination of icons in three display fields in a banner area of the display. The combination of icons is selected from a plurality of icon combinations based on the determined first connection status and the second connection status. | 11-04-2010 |
| 20110010307 | METHOD AND SYSTEM FOR RECOMMENDING ARTICLES AND PRODUCTS - In a data processing system, a method of recommending articles and products to a user is disclosed. The method creates a frequency vector in relation to the content of an article, frequency vectors in relation each of one or more products from intermediate data. The method compares the vectors to determine a content similarity measure, and provides as output a list of one or more products having the highest content similarity measures. The method may also determine a correlation measure. An electronic data processing system for recommending articles and products to a user is also disclosed. The system includes modules to receive article information and product information, a correlation module to determine a content similarity measure between the article and each of the products and, a multiplexer module for providing a list comprising the article and the products associated having the highest content similarity measure. | 01-13-2011 |

| 20110093804 | SCREEN OBJECT PLACEMENT OPTIMIZED FOR BLIND SELECTION - An improved handheld electronic device includes an input apparatus, an output apparatus, and a processor apparatus. The input apparatus includes a multi-axis input device such as a rollerball, trackball, joystick or touchpad, allowing the focus of a user interface program to be moved about a display from one screen object presented on that display to another. Up to four screen objects are presented on the display, each of those screen objects being positioned towards a corner of the display to enable a user to blindly operate the multi-axis input device, making use of a capture effect in which the focus of a user interface program is resisted from moving beyond an edge of the display, to guide movement of the focus to a given one of the up to four screen objects. | 04-21-2011 |
